Re: Scheduler Question
You have to do two schedules, one for weekdays, one for Saturday only, I don't think there is way within TSM you can do in one job. Otherwise, you have to schedule outside the TSM, using AT on NT or win2k, Crontab on AIX to handle the schedule. Re: MS exchange backup problem - Unable to perform an incremental backup
It is true, the full backup running during the weekend was failed due to TCP/IP connection failure. Thanks. Rosa Bruce Kamp [EMAIL PROTECTED]@VM.MARIST.EDU on 10/31/2001 10:57:13 AM Please respond to ADSM: Dist Stor Manager [EMAIL PROTECTED] Sent by: ADSM: Dist Stor Manager [EMAIL PROTECTED] To: [EMAIL PROTECTED] cc: Subject: Re: MS exchange backup problem - Unable to perform an incremental backup Check to see if your full backup failed. You can not do an incremental backup of the exchange information store with out a full backup. I had the same problem with Exchange 5.5 TDP 2.2... Hope this helps.
